Through its online platform, text chat, trained peer-support interventionists and suicide-prevention resources, Death2Life connects with hurting people around the clock, without charging the individual seeking help.
The organization primarily serves teens and young adults but has supported people ranging from children to older adults and has reached individuals across the United States and around the world.
SEPTEMBER'S MESSAGE: DON'T DISAPPEAR
Throughout Suicide Prevention Month, Death2Life is encouraging individuals, churches, families, schools, businesses and communities to become more intentional about noticing people who may be struggling.
D2L is asking people to:
- Reach out. Check on the person who has become unusually quiet or withdrawn.
- Listen. You do not need perfect words to sit with someone who is hurting.
- Take suicidal statements seriously. Never assume someone is simply looking for attention.
- Help people connect with support. No one should carry suicidal thoughts alone.
- Share Death2Life. Visit Death2Life.com or text D2L to 91627.
- Remind people to stay. A devastating chapter does not have to become the end of their story.
"Hopelessness tells people there is no way forward," D'Ortenzio said. "We want to interrupt that lie. There is another moment coming. There is another conversation coming. There is hope. And ultimately, we believe there is a Savior who sees them, loves them and has not abandoned them."
